>Just wanted to let everyone know about a DVD project
>that was just released - The California Tour DVD
>features the experiemntal films about California that
>Melinda Stone took on tour to rural California
>drive-ins during the summer of 2003. The DVD is an
>unusual blend of bingo, sing-a-longs, experimental
>films, rural audiences and the decaying beauty of the
>remaining California drive-ins. It was a great tour, and in the
>time-honored tradition of itinerant film exhibition.
>
>The DVD contains a short documentary of Stone's tour,
>information on each drive-in, filmmaker contact
>information, and a selection of the films screened
>including an excerpt of Pat O’Neill’s stunning Decay
>of Fiction and a collaborative film by myself and Natalija Vekic, diggins.
>
>Microcinema International is selling the DVD. Check it out.
